www.dell.com | support.dell.com CAUTION: Before you begin any of the procedures in this section, follow the safety instructions on page 9. CAUTION: To guard against electrical shock, always unplug your computer from the electrical outlet before opening the cover. The computer's card connectors allow you to install different types of devices such as modems, network adapters, and video cards. Installing a Card Before you begin any of the procedures in this section, follow the safety instructions on page 9. 1 If you are replacing a card, remove the current driver for the card from the operating system. 2 Shut down the computer (see page 22). NOTICE: To disconnect a network cable, first unplug the cable from your computer and then unplug it from the network wall jack. 3 Turn off any attached devices and disconnect them from their electrical outlets. 4 Disconnect the computer power cable from the wall outlet, and then press the power button to ground the system board. 5 Open the computer cover (see page 66). 6 Press the tab on the card retention arm and raise the retention arm. 70 Adding Parts
